Fish recorded near this station
Community observations nearbyShellpot Creek At Wilmington, DE has 53 fish species documented via iNaturalist research-grade observations within 10 km. These community-sourced records indicate fish presence in the vicinity.
Species include: Atlantic Sturgeon (Acipenser oxyrinchus), Hickory Shad (Alosa mediocris), American Shad (Alosa sapidissima), Rock Bass (Ambloplites rupestris), White Catfish (Ameiurus catus), and 48 others.

4 species above are flagged non-native or potentially invasive (Goldfish, Northern Snakehead, Grass Carp, European Carp). Records show what has been observed near this station, not what is native to the watershed.
